                              Administrative Services

                              Administration of your business can weigh you down! Everything from preparing for meetings, managing data, creating marketing materials and communicating with clients can eat up a big part of any business owner's day. We help our clients identify the "little things" that add up to a lot of time then devise ways to delegate those tasks so that they can focus on more profitable work. Here are some areas in which ExtendedOffice can offer support:
                              • Meeting management: Prepare, produce and distribute meeting materials including: agenda, financials and any other requested supporting materials; supply printed copies of meeting materials as requested.
                              • Database Management: data entry, database management, mail merge and mailing labels.
                              • Marketing support: electronic slide presentations, email marketing, quote proposals, flyers, menus, brochures, invitations, newsletters, nametags, business cards, holiday cards and postcards.
                              • General admin: monitor email and postal mail; maintain paperless filing system / data archive; monitor data back up; manage supplies and materials, order additional supplies and purchase as needed.
